GDC/15 · Bestanddeel · 24 July 1794
Part of Gray, Dodsworth & Cobb, York solicitors

Probate of the will of Reverend Joseph Stoney late of the parish of Trelawney in the county of Cornwall and Island (of Jamaica). Attested by appending the Broad Seal of this Island (Jamaica) the 16th day of May 1797 by The Right Honourable Alexander Earl of Balearres Lieutenant Governor and Commander in Chief in and over this His Majesty’s Island of Jamaica and other the Territories thereon by appending the Broad Seal of this Island. Large heavy round seal attached. He gives his slaves to Joanna Adams, a free mulatto woman, with instructions that on her death one of them is to be freed and paid £10 current money of Jamaica per year. Mentions the Stoney family of Pateley Bridge in Yorkshire.
